Lucky Star - 01 - Very enjoyable!
Having read through some reviews, and comments, I wonder why all their reviews turned out that way. Tune your expectations correctly, remember that it’s an adaptation of a 4-koma, then enjoy it like you would love Azumanga Daioh.
The start introduces Konata as a very athletic girl. Just that her interests is focused on games and anime. (how very real) Together with Tsukasa, Konata soon starts a conversation about how to eat chocolate cream puffs, which gradually led to how to eat other kinds of food when Miyuki joined in. (I eat the same kinds of food, and probably had the same kind of discussions when i was young. but if there was a joke here, it flew right past me)
4-koma joke of a guy who locks up girls and forces them to call him goshujin-sama. Konata claims that there’s no deeper meaning, probably the guy just played too much galge and eroge. Now how does she know that as a high school girl.
Konata points out to Tsukasa that Miyuki is the epitome of moe. Totally. from thoughts to actions.
Kagami is sick with a cold. Tsukasa says it’s probably not influenza. Konata points out that it’s lucky that konata is stupid. (stupid ppl dont’ catch colds, so they shouldn’t catch influenza right?) Thus miyuki becomes to judge as to whether influenza is “upgraded cold”. The punch line is that Konata gets pissed that through the whole incident, Tsukasa didn’t disagree that Konata is stupid.
Konata comes to visit. Kagami is all happy and touched. But actually.. Konata just came over to copy homework.
Miyuki visits next, and she’s almost a perfect angel. Tsukasa didn’t realise there’s visitors though, and popped over to say hi to her sister Kagami, only to be horrified that a visitor would see her feeling so sleepy. The two end up having the most bimbotic chat though, to Kagami’s horror.
Physical health check. Kagami blames the weight gain on the ribbon on her bra. Tsukasa is horrified that she wore “mature undergarments” on physical health check day. Konata didn’t grow. Miyuki? Perfect score.
Kagami asks konata if she has any other friends. Yes… except that the middle high school best friend turned out to be some maniac as well. It seems that Konata and Tsukasa became best friends after Konata saves Tsukasa from a foreigner using street fight moves. Except that the foreigner was just asking for directions. More food chat after that!
I don’t know where this came from. But the joke’s about a idol who answers a question of how much money she gets. The answer became a rant about how her marketing company and parents take all her money.
The show ends with Konata singing ktv and a game theme song if i’m not wrong sentai (think power rangers) theme song (see comments). Behind closed doors.
Thoughts
This show is definitely not trying to seduce you with moe. Shows like Manabi straight and Sumomomo are. In fact, lucky star takes the otaku theme and makes plenty of fun and jokes at it.
The style is definitely Azumanga Daioh type, and you can really tell that it’s an adaptation from 4-koma. (the plot comes in small pieces. Enough to fit into 4 boxes in a comic i guess)
If Kyoani uses this to diversify its image, i’m all for it. I’m still impressed with the animation. (just compare it to something similar like Azumanga) Kyoani really brings out the comic feel, although some might say that it’s cheapening out on the animation. But I think there are styles that just suit different genres. In fact, I’m impressed that Kyoani seem to be doing well in adapting from all sorts of genre and material.
Other than the food discussion… the jokes were all very cute and subtle but funny to me. I smacked my forehead when “de arimasu” came out though. haha. Even the ktv part at the end was cute to me. Guess you need to go to KTV in an asian country to totally understand it.
Is this any like FMP or Haruhi or Kanon? No. Was this episode good? Definitely. People need to open their taste more.

The ED is not a game theme, but rather the OP from an old 70’s super sentai series called “Uchu Tetsujin Kyodain”:
